Drew Curtright is living the dream of any young artist. She's creating art full-time and she's adapted a beautiful etching process that she discovered while studying photography at Nebraska Wesleyan University. Drew says, "Their art program requires you to take a 3-D art course as well and so I decided to take metalsmithing for my 3-D course and it never let me go."

Just five years out of college, this 2013 Nebraska Wesleyan graduate is a full-time jewelry maker that spends many hours a week working in her studio...dreaming and creating. She says, "We all wear jewelry for different reasons, sometimes it reminds us of a loved one or sometimes we just want to say, 'Hey, I'm wacky and cool, I have this big piece of jewelry on.' But we all have our own meanings to what we wear and I think that's really amazing."

This 28-year-old says it was studying ancient civilizations in an art history class at Wesleyan that really helped her formulate the look feel of her jewelry line, "That really got me interested in thinking about why we create art and then why we adorn ourselves with art."

Drew merges those two thoughts into her jewelry, "One of the first things I start with generally is the piece that I want to use from historical pattern work. Like with this piece here I started with these elongated pieces which have kind of an Egyptian feel to them."

Drew is proud to have her fingerprints on every piece of jewelry that she sells, "There's blood, sweat and sometimes tears in each piece."

This Lincoln Northeast High School graduate says the time in now for one of a kind, hand-made art, "I think what I've heard a lot, especially from people in my generation is that they're tired of the mass produced feel of things."
